There needs to be design innovation to minimize the impact of environmental water pollution, one of the simple environmentally friendly technologies for treating wastewater is Constructed Wetland (CW) technology. The application of Constructed Wetland (CW) for household wastewater treatment in Cibunut Village, Kebon Pisang Subdistrict, Bandung City using ornamental plants Iris (Iris pseudoacorus), Water Jasmine (Echinodorus palaefolius) and a combination of both for 2 months, showed that the combination of plants was able to reduce COD, TSS and BOD better than single plants, with efficiencies reaching 95%, 94% and 85% respectively.
